Turbo Texas Hold’em, Turbo 7 Card Stud, Tournament Texas Hold’em, Turbo Omaha HI/LOThese are Wilson poker software that claim to produce the most realistic simulation of poker nowadays. But users and reviewers say that their interface could be so cranky and is hard to set-up.
DD Tournament PokerThis poker software is said to be perfect for beginners and experienced players alike. 5000 computer opponents are available in this program and one can choose from three skill levels. Poker aficionados also have the choice of playing a pre-define tournament or to customize one that will meet their specifications.
Holdem Inspector 2This is a poker software that has this innovative feature of allowing one to analyze his game and study a certain situation, thus the name. It also enables players to put up various profiles to test different techniques for many poker situations.
Seven Card Inspector 2This is labeled as the “little brother” of the Holdem Inspector 2 poker software. Though it has the ability to track up cards and outs, the available profiles are not that commendable. It does not also allow you to run complex simulations. This software apparently has bad reviews on its belt.
Poker Pal Pro, Tellis SoftwareThis poker software is reported to look really good but has bad execution. Aside from losing important info as players change, this program does not update well also.
PokerStoveThis is a Texas Holdem poker calculator that boasts to fully analyze complex preflop situations about 100 times faster than other available tools.
Crazy Pineapple This poker software claims to have an easy installation feature and a smart computer advisor. It has an internet play and a watch play that for the purpose of learning.
Poker OfficeThis is said to be one of the most well-developed poker software since their first versions. Its features are its ability to automatically track stats, import old hand histories, and its giving of advice on how to improve the game. Review has it that this poker software is worth one’s money.
Mobile Poker TrainerThis poker software is a good download for the cellphone. This is the mobile version of the Texas Hold’em poker software. It’s good to kick boredom away with this poker software in your mobile phone. The downside of this program is its being limited to five characters that have predictable playing strategies. Reviewers say that it does not live out its name, it’s better off as a video game.
